Year: 1987
Runtime: 91 mins
Language: English
Director: Robert Mandel
After his father dies, a suburban teen runs away and lands on Chicago’s South Side, where he’s mugged and bonds with a street‑wise youngster. Together they steal a gangster’s Mercedes that hides a corpse, then drive the car on a reckless journey southward in search of the hustler’s estranged father, even eleven‑year‑olds can handle danger and fun.
